Philip Skingley, formerly head of the book department at Spink & Son for over 20 years, where he also managed the coin department, has been brought on board to oversee the development of the website.

Jennifer Mulholland, also formerly of Spink, and more recently auction manager at Baldwin’s, joins to oversee the administration of the mail order team which processes around 4000 orders a month. She will also manage the firm’s increased media relations and presence on social media.

Isabelle Marion will be heading the accounts department. She has previously managed the accounts of several companies. Christina MacDonald, who has previous experience in retail numismatics at Baldwin’s, joins the shop team to develop her interest in ancient coins and antiquities.

Coincraft’s premises is opposite the British Museum in London.
